Understanding SQLite PRAGMA Statement Usage
Q: What is the purpose of the PRAGMA statement in SQLite?
- SQL Lite
- Senior level question
Explore all the latest SQL Lite interview questions and answers
ExploreMost Recent & up-to date
100% Actual interview focused
Create SQL Lite interview for FREE!
The PRAGMA statement in SQLite is used to query and set various information and flags within the SQLite environment. It is usually used to perform administrative operations such as setting the database page size, enabling or disabling features, and retrieving version information.
For example, a PRAGMA statement can be used to set the page_size parameter for a database. This allows the user to control the size of the pages used for the database file.
In general, the syntax for a PRAGMA statement is:
PRAGMA [()]
Here are some examples of using the PRAGMA statement in SQLite:
1. Retrieve the version of SQLite:
PRAGMA version;
2. Enable foreign key support:
PRAGMA foreign_keys = ON;
3. Set the page size of the database:
PRAGMA page_size = 4096;
4. Retrieve the number of bytes in a page:
PRAGMA page_size;
For example, a PRAGMA statement can be used to set the page_size parameter for a database. This allows the user to control the size of the pages used for the database file.
In general, the syntax for a PRAGMA statement is:
PRAGMA
Here are some examples of using the PRAGMA statement in SQLite:
1. Retrieve the version of SQLite:
PRAGMA version;
2. Enable foreign key support:
PRAGMA foreign_keys = ON;
3. Set the page size of the database:
PRAGMA page_size = 4096;
4. Retrieve the number of bytes in a page:
PRAGMA page_size;


